If I had my way
Martin Nowak
dawg at dawgfoto.de
Wed Dec 14 02:39:03 PST 2011
On Wed, 14 Dec 2011 05:54:19 +0100, Walter Bright
<newshound2 at digitalmars.com> wrote:
> On 12/13/2011 4:12 AM, Martin Nowak wrote:
>> On x86-64 the PIC code is working fine, but there were some relocation
>> issues left.
>> https://github.com/dawgfoto/dmd/commits/SharedElf
>
> I see some good stuff there. When will you be ready for a pull request?
I don't think that this belongs in the current release if that's what you
meant.
So far I haven't found any regressions with these changes.
One part I'm not positive about is setting the size of public data symbols
to the DT size.
I also just found another issue with runtime relocations and EH so there
will
be a little more in this direction but if you don't see any issues with the
data symbols we might as well merge it sooner than later.
martin
More information about the Digitalmars-d
mailing list